K27155546: BIND vulnerability CVE-2022-38177
Security Advisory Description By spoofing the target resolver with responses that have a malformed ECDSA signature, an attacker can trigger a small memory leak. It is possible to gradually erode available memory to the point where named crashes for lack of resources. CVE-2022-38177 Impact There i...

K14204: BIND vulnerability CVE-2011-4313
Security Advisory Description ISC reports that query.c in BIND may allow remote attackers to cause a denial-of-service assertion failure and named exit. The vulnerability uses unknown vectors related to recursive DNS queries, error logging, and the caching of an invalid record by the resolver. Th...

K10092301: BIND vulnerability CVE-2019-6471
Security Advisory Description A race condition which may occur when discarding malformed packets can result in BIND exiting due to a REQUIRE assertion failure in dispatch.c. Versions affected: BIND 9.11.0 - 9.11.7, 9.12.0 - 9.12.4-P1, 9.14.0 - 9.14.2. Also all releases of the BIND 9.13 developmen...
